When self-care [1] comes to mind, many of us may associate the practice with baths, naps, and yoga. And while those are definitely a few ways to address your needs, self-care encompasses far more than that. In fact, according to the self-care wheel created by trauma prevention expert Olga Phoenix [2], self-care includes six parts that are vital to managing stress and achieving happiness and life satisfaction.
"I originally designed the self-care wheel for me, personally, as a tool to get to that seemingly unattainable place of life balance, meaning, and contentment," Olga told POPSUGAR. "It is an empowering, affirming, and positive tool, comprised of six dimensions: physical, psychological, emotional, spiritual, personal, and professional. Each dimension represents a part of our lives which requires our daily attention."
Effectively practicing self-care [3] requires making sure the needs of each of the wheel's dimensions are met with meaning, and evaluating which areas still need improvement. Physical
- Exercise
- Sleep
- Unplug
- Eat healthy
- Be sexual
- Get regular medical checkups
Psychological
- Go to therapy
- Journal
- Self-reflect
- Relax
- Ask for help
- Do something creative
Emotional
- Laugh
- Find a hobby
- Practice self-love
- Cry
- Forgive
- Cuddle with your pet
Spiritual
- Spend time outdoors
- Meditate
- Volunteer
- Practice yoga
- Pray
- Get inspired
Personal
- Create a vision board
- Get out of debt
- Establish goals
- Spend time with loved ones
- Learn who you are
- Cook
Professional
- Leave work at work
- Take vacation, sick, and mental health days
- Plan your next career move
- Take lunches
- Avoid working during days off
- Learn to say no
